Linda Knapp

Linda Knapp provides management, technical support, and educational services for sustainability initiatives in both the public and private sectors. For the past twenty years she has worked for the Institute for Local Self-Reliance’s Waste to Wealth Program in researching and promoting recycling economic development projects throughout the Mid-Atlantic region. Since 2008, she has managed EPA-funded outreach and technical support activities for the growing organics recovery infrastructure in the region. Linda has been successful in securing state, federal, and foundation funding for policy development, demonstration projects, and promotional programs that support sustainable, community-based businesses. She has effectively implemented a wide range of educational programs ranging from neighborhood workshops to national, professional conferences and trade shows. In addition, she is an educator who has taught marketing and management courses at the Community College of Philadelphia for more than ten years. She is a member of the Community College of Philadelphia Business Division team that is developing the new Entrepreneurship Certificate Program that began in Spring 2014.
